查看: 391|回复: 0

[E易语言] 易语言KMP算法内存特征码搜索源码

[复制链接]
发表于 2019-10-31 10:16 | 显示全部楼层 |阅读模式
官方团队 2019-10-31 10:16 391 0 显示全部楼层
e710df1dgy1g8g6orygwfj20eq0bw0st.jpg

KMP算法是一种改进的字符串匹配算法,由D.E.Knuth,J.H.Morris和V.R.Pratt同时发现,因此人们称它为克努特·莫里斯·普拉特操作(简称KMP算法)。KMP算法的关键是利用匹配失败后的信息,尽量减少模式串与主串的匹配次数以达到快速匹配的目的。具体实现就是实现一个next()函数,函数本身包含了模式串的局部匹配信息。时间复杂度O(m+n)

Kmp_SearchEX.rar

3.2 KB, 下载次数: 16, 下载积分: 牛币 -2 个

易语言KMP

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则 返回列表 发新帖

快速回复 返回顶部 返回列表